The "Champ Renard" vineyard of Domaine Adélie is located at the entrance of the village of Mercurey. In terms of wine, it is worked according to the same spirit and the same traditional methods as the Chardonnay vines. Bourgogne Aligoté is an appellation produced throughout Burgundy and found mainly in the vineyards of Auxerrois, Côte Chalonnaise and Hautes Côtes de Beaune and Nuits.

The Bichot family winery is one of the most influential producers in Burgundy. The family settled there in 1350 and in 1831 Bernard Bichot started a wine business in Monthélie, on the Côte de Beaune and his son Hippolyte bought the first vines in Volnay. Son Albert Bichot gave the family business a new impulse at the end of the 19th century and settled permanently in the city of Beaune, where it is still located 5 centuries later. At that time the wines were already famous worldwide.

- Tasting note
- The Aligoté grape from Champ Renard both gives the sensation of a wine with a modest approach, but which provides freshness and roundness through its aging. It reveals notes of white flowers and dried fruits, with a nice consistency in the mouth.
- Wine-food combination
- It accompanies simply prepared fish and seafood. It will also be served as an aperitif.
- Vinification
- The wine is vinified in thermoregulated tanks in 5 to 6 weeks and remains in stainless steel tanks for another 8 months for ageing.
- Soil
- Sandy loam and clay-limestone soils
- Serving temperature
- Serve between 10 and 13°C
